position
Position refers to where a player is sitting relative to the button. Position is a key strategy criteria as it decides the betting order for the players.
Players are typically indicated as being in early, middle, or late position. In a nine player table the first three players to the left of the dealer are in early position, the next three in middle position, and the last three in late position.
Many of the positions at a table have specific terms referring to them.
- small blind - first player left of the dealer
- big blind - player immediately to the left of the small blind
- under the gun - the first player to act, one to the left of the big blind in hold'em
- hijack - two to the right of the dealer
- cutoff - player immediately to the right of the dealer
- button - the dealer
